Fibrinolysis: strategies to enhance the treatment of acute ischemic stroke

Abstract: Stroke is a major cause of disability worldwide, and is the second leading cause of death after ischemic heart disease. Until recently, tissue-type plasminogen activator (t-PA) was the only treatment for acute ischemic stroke. If administered within 4.5 h of symptom onset, t-PA improves the outcome in stroke patients. Mechanical thrombectomy is now the preferred treatment for patients with acute ischemic stroke resulting from a large-artery occlusion in the anterior circulation. “…Inhibitors of activated TAFI (TAFIa) are being investigated for enhancement of endogenous fibrinolysis (Table 2). 65 When thrombin is generated, TAFI is activated by the thrombinthrombomodulin complex. TAFIa attenuates fibrinolysis by removing C-terminal lysine and arginine residues from partially degraded fibrin.…”

“…Since 2015, mechanical thrombectomy has become the first-line treatment for anterior circulation stroke with proximal large-artery occlusion. However, only about 20% of stroke patients have large-artery occlusion and it is a challenge to deliver treatment to them within the 24-h time window because the procedure can only be performed in highly specialized centers [6]. In general, for more patients who cannot accept thrombolysis or mechanical thrombectomy, it is essential to elucidate the molecular mechanisms underlying IS and explore potential therapeutic targets to restore function after stroke.…”

“…Ischemic stroke, which occurs suddenly due to thromboembolic occlusion of a major artery that supplies blood to the brain, represents the most common type and requires restoration of blood flow immediately. Thrombolytic agents and endovascular mechanical thrombectomy are the only treatment options to achieve recanalization with their limited therapeutic time window and side effects such as risk of hemorrhage [67]. On the other hand, hemorrhagic stroke occurs secondary to rupture and bleeding of a vessel in the brain and requires immediate surgery to remove clots and blood and decrease intracranial pressure [68].…”
